At 92, this Italian sprinter has the fitness of someone decades younger; here’s why

Italian sprinter Emma Mazzenga, who holds multiple world records in the 90–94 age category, is helping scientists uncover how exercise may slow the ageing process. According to reports, researchers studying her cardiorespiratory fitness and muscle function found that her mitochondria, the energy-producing structures within muscle cells, are remarkably healthy and function similarly to those of...

IIT Bhubaneswar develops hand-held device to detect arsenic

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Bhubaneswar has innovated a device to detect arsenic that would help improve water quality monitoring and public health. Researchers from the Sensors and Spectroscopy Research Group, School of Electrical and Computer Sciences (SECS), IIT Bhubaneswar, led by Sayan Dey have made significant advances in arsenic detection technologies, said the institute in...
